Time for a new Leander McNelly. He was a legendary Texas Ranger Captain who famously led his small company of 12 Rangers across the Rio Grande to attack hundreds of rustlers who were nominally part of the Mexican army under Generals Juan Cortina and Juan Salinas.

McNelly asked for no quarter nor gave it. His recorded orders before one fight against the bandits was: “Don’t shoot to the left or the right. Shoot straight ahead. And don’t shoot till you’ve got your target good in your sights. Don’t walk up on a wounded man. Pay no attention to a white flag. That’s a mean trick bandits use on green-hands. Don’t touch a dead man, except to identify him.”
